Default Open your saddlebag/TP, what ya got?

Wondering what yall keep on you the majority of time. Heres my typical list:

RIGHT BAG (always 75% full):
Gerbings Rain Gear
Snap-on full face clear visor, for my half helmet when it pours
some tools / spare bungee cords

LEFT BAG (about 20% full, without helmet):
can of quick spray polish
few old tshirts for dusting/polishing
some tools
dual cup holder (made by me) for when wifey sends me to get us coffee
half-helmet (when im not using it lol)

When im needing some extra space I Bungee my raingear to the back of my sissybar because it takes up almost 50% of my saddlebag! The Gerbings pouch isnt all that bad looking, so I dont mind it on there and its out of the way.

How about you? What ya got in there??

Left bag - Tool bag with 3/8" socket set up to 1", 1/4" socket set up to 9/16. Both deep and shallow in both sizes. Ratchets and extensions. Wrenches from 1/4" to 1". Screwdrivers, pliers, knife, tape, fuses, bulbs, bungee cords, ratchet straps, and prolly other stuff. (I'm an aircraft mechanic, and never leave home without tools).

Right bag - typically empty so I can use it for travel.
